What Is an AI Marketing Agency or AI Marketing Platform?
An AI marketing agency uses people and AI tools to deliver marketing services. An AI marketing platform gives businesses software for planning, execution, automation, optimization, and reporting. Both models can support growth, but they differ in ownership, visibility, cost structure, speed, data access, and how directly teams manage digital marketing workflows.
An AI marketing agency is a service provider that uses AI tools to support strategy, content, campaigns, reporting, and optimization. The agency team may include SEO specialists, paid media managers, designers, writers, analysts, and account managers.
Most agencies work through monthly retainers, project pricing, or campaign scopes. Their services often include SEO, paid ads, social media, content marketing, email marketing, creative strategy, and reporting. This model can help when a business lacks internal marketing capacity or needs high touch consulting.

AI Marketing Platform vs AI Marketing Agency: Quick Comparison and Key Differences
The practical difference is simple. Agencies are expert led and service led. Platforms are system led and automation led. Agencies can provide strategic depth and creative direction, while platforms give business owners more direct access to campaigns, dashboards, leads, expenses, optimization workflows, and measurable digital marketing performance across channels.
| Criteria | AI Marketing Agency | AI Marketing Platform | Best Fit |
|---|---|---|---|
| Execution speed | Depends on briefing, approvals, and team availability | Faster through automation and built in workflows | Platform for recurring execution |
| Cost structure | Retainers, project fees, and scope based pricing | SaaS style subscription or platform based pricing | Platform for predictable control |
| Scalability | May require larger scopes and more specialists | Scales across campaigns, teams, and locations | Platform for growing businesses |
| Level of control | Execution often happens outside internal systems | Teams access dashboards and workflows directly | Platform for direct control |
| Transparency | Reports may be scheduled or manually compiled | Live dashboards and performance views | Platform for real time visibility |
| Reporting and analytics | Often monthly or campaign based | Continuous tracking and ROI reporting | Platform for data driven decisions |
| Campaign optimization | Specialist led recommendations | AI assisted monitoring and optimization | Both, depending on complexity |
| AI search readiness | Varies by agency expertise | Built into advanced AI marketing platforms | Platform for AI search visibility |
| CRM and lead tracking | May depend on separate systems | Connected lead tracking and CRM workflows | Platform for sales alignment |
| Multi channel management | Often split across teams and tools | Unified execution across channels | Platform for lower complexity |
| Dependency on external teams | Higher | Lower | Platform for internal agility |
| Suitability for SMBs | Useful when outsourcing is preferred | Strong fit for automation and visibility | Platform for lean teams |

When Each Marketing Model Makes Sense
An agency makes sense when a company wants external expertise, creative thinking, and fully managed execution. A platform makes more sense when the business needs automation, direct visibility, CRM connected lead tracking, AI search optimization, cost savings, and scalable marketing operations. Many companies can also combine both models for strategy and control.
An AI marketing agency can be the right choice when a business has no internal marketing capacity. It helps when leadership wants to outsource strategy, creative development, campaign setup, content, and reporting.
Agencies are also useful for brand positioning, video concepts, complex launch campaigns, and high touch consulting. Human specialists still play a strong role in creative strategy and market interpretation.

A hybrid model can also work well. In this setup, an agency or consultant supports strategy while the business retains platform access, performance data, and lead visibility. This gives leaders human input without losing operational control.
Model 1: Agency Led
This model is best for companies that want fully outsourced execution. It works when budget is available, internal marketing capacity is limited, and the leadership team prefers high touch support over direct control.
Model 2: Platform Led
This model is best for companies that want automation, visibility, direct control, and scalable lead generation. It is often ideal for SMBs, startups, local businesses, and in house teams that need a practical AI marketing agency alternative.
Model 3: Hybrid
This model works when a business wants strategic human input plus software led execution. An agency or consultant can use the platform, while the business retains its data, dashboards, workflows, and lead visibility.
